
A dog attack in Thamesville has led to multiple charges.
Police were called shortly before 6:30 p.m. Thursday for the report of a canine attack on Victoria Street in Thamesville.
Officers learned a 55-year-old Chatham man was nipped while trying to pry an unrestrained dog from his own pooch. Police say the man didn’t require medical attention, but his dog did.
The officers identified the owner of the off-leash dog, and they learned the was wanted on an outstanding warrant for failing to comply with a probation order.
A 50-year-old Chatham-Kent woman faces a charge of failing to comply.
